It’s iOS update season again, and email marketers need to get ready. The good news is that while iOS 18 is expected to be released in mid to late September, similar to previous years, the changes affecting Apple Mail aren’t available in beta yet. This likely means they won’t be part of the initial update. (Don’t take my word for it. Apple’s preview mentioned that the changes are “ coming later this year ,” which, to me, makes it more likely they’ll be released separately and at a later date.

That’s the goal of Osmo, a startup using artificial intelligence technology to help computers “generate smells like we generate images and sounds,” according to the company’s website. CEO and co-founder Alex Wiltschko believes giving computers the ability to process scent can help with healthcare. “We’ve known that smell contains information we can use to detect disease, but computers can’t speak that language and can’t interpret that data yet,” he told CNBC.

Google is updating its advertising policies for financial products, specifically focusing on cryptocurrencies. The new rules will take effect on Sept. 20. Why it matters: The new policy clarifies Google’s stance on cryptocurrency-related ads in Switzerland, aiming to ensure that only compliant and licensed entities can promote their services. Google is launching a beta program that allows advertisers to activate Microsoft automated bidding within Search Ads 360 bid strategies. Why we care. Enterprise advertisers can now optimize their campaigns across multiple search engines more effectively, potentially increasing conversions by 5%. How it works: Microsoft automated bidding optimizes bids at the auction level in real-time.

Google rolled out version 202408 of its Ad Manager API, introducing new capabilities for advertisers and publishers. Why we care. The update enhances contextual targeting options and provides new tools for managing and analyzing ad supply chains, potentially improving ad relevance and transparency. Key features: Contextual targeting: Advertisers can now use ContentLabelTargeting and VerticalTargeting for more precise ad placement.
